摘    要:在非细胞体系中以细胞色素C作为诱导剂,诱导小鼠有细胞核发生凋亡,在透射电子显微镜及扫描电子显微镜下观察到凋亡的一现典型的凋亡形态学特征,整装电镜的结果显示,在凋亡过程中核基质结构被破坏,但核基质结构仍然存在,并最终形成凋亡小体的结构基础。

Abstract:We induced apoptosis of mouse nuclei in cell free system using cytochrome C. The apoptotic nucleus displayed the typical apoptotic character when it was observed under transmission electron microscope and scanning electron microscope. The results of whole mount electron microscopy indicated that nuclear matrix still existed during the course of apoptosis, whereas lamina system was destroyed. It was nuclear matrix that connected the apoptotic bodies and apoptotic nucleus, which laid the structural foundation of apoptotic bodies.
